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
959 78290464290 2253298
3541605 1196489129
3541605 1196489129
484 90 29229684514
All about undefined
Interested in learning more?
3541605 1196489129
484 90 29229684514
See more
15364 935053
3528410 1635 554950 35 260072
See more
301391979 5674
6140043 2024 73552308
See more